Mission: To develop multi capable vehicle maintenance professionals ready to deliver tomorrows global Force Generation demands.  

 

Vision: To be the premier Vehicle Maintenance Training Center in the Air Force.  

 

About: The 346th Training Squadron provides initial and supplemental training to Vehicle Maintenance and Management professionals at Port Hueneme, California.
